Automotive Expanded Polypropylene (EPP) Foam Market Advances as Electric Vehicle Manufacturing Boosts Material Demand
The global Automotive Expanded Polypropylene (EPP) Foam Market is experiencing robust growth as automotive manufacturers increasingly prioritize lightweight materials, vehicle safety enhancements, and sustainability objectives. According to the latest industry analysis by Fact.MR, the market is projected to grow from US$ 510.1 million in 2024 to US$ 957.5 million by 2034, expanding at a CAGR of 6.5% during the forecast period. The growing emphasis on fuel efficiency, electric vehicle range optimization, crash protection systems, and recyclable vehicle components continues to accelerate adoption of EPP foam across automotive platforms.

Expanded polypropylene foam has emerged as a preferred material among OEMs due to its unique combination of impact resistance, lightweight properties, thermal insulation, acoustic performance, durability, and recyclability. Its widespread use in bumpers, headrests, door panels, seating systems, floor levelers, parcel shelves, and battery protection structures is positioning the material as a critical enabler of next-generation vehicle design.

Market Size Snapshot
- Market Size (2024): US$ 510.1 Million
- Forecast Market Value (2034): US$ 957.5 Million
- Projected CAGR (2024-2034): 6.5%
- North America Market Share (2024): 28.7%
- East Asia Market Share (2034): 28.0%
- China Market Value (2034): US$ 216 Million

Market Drivers Supporting Industry Expansion
Vehicle Lightweighting and Fuel Efficiency
Automotive manufacturers are increasingly deploying lightweight materials to improve fuel economy and extend electric vehicle range. EPP foam delivers substantial weight savings while maintaining structural integrity and safety performance.
Growth of Electric Vehicles
Electric vehicle manufacturers are utilizing EPP foam in battery protection systems, thermal management structures, and energy absorption components to enhance performance and safety.
Enhanced Safety Requirements
The material's superior energy absorption characteristics make it ideal for side-impact protection, bumpers, headrests, and crash management systems.
Sustainability and Recyclability
As circular economy initiatives gain momentum, OEMs are adopting recyclable materials that support environmental objectives and regulatory compliance.

Supply Chain and Value Chain Intelligence
The Automotive EPP Foam value chain comprises:
Polypropylene Resin Producers → Foam Bead Manufacturers → EPP Processors → Component Manufacturers → Tier-1 Suppliers → Automotive OEMs → Vehicle Assembly Plants
Key supply chain inputs include:
- Polypropylene resin
- Blowing agents
- Molded foam technologies
- Advanced tooling systems
- Automotive-grade additives
Manufacturers are increasingly regionalizing supply chains to improve resilience and reduce logistics costs amid evolving global trade dynamics.
